GI-related issues when taking iron or B12 on an empty stomach, ... WebAug 13, 2024 · Taking up to 3,000 mg carbonyl iron daily cured anemia in the majority of patients after 12 weeks. Researchers found that the benefits of carbonyl iron were that they are relatively inexpensive, are effective for iron deficiency anemia, and cause fewer symptoms of digestive upset. There is also less risk of iron poisoning in cases of overdose.

WebPatients just starting iron supplementation may notice stomach pain or upset. To reduce the risk of these symptoms, doctors may start the patient on a half dose of iron at first, working up to a full dose within a few weeks.
